Resumo:Interview conducted for Voices from the Catholic Worker. Thaddeus "Spike" Zywicki discusses his experiences in the Catholic Worker Movement. He talks about his background and how he eventually became involved with the Catholic Worker Movement. He discusses the various houses he has worked at, and focuses on his work with Michael Kirwan at his houses of hospitality in Washington, D.C. He talks about the spiritual aspects of the Catholic Worker and how it's shaped his life. Interviewed by Rosalie Riegle Troester. Interruptions in audio present in original recording.
